Understanding the Difference: Chronological vs. Biological Age
Your chronological age is the number of years you've been alive, a simple metric that doesn't reflect your body's internal state. Your biological age, however, is a more accurate measure of your overall health, determined by a variety of biomarkers including DNA methylation and telomere length. A person with a biological age younger than their chronological age is generally healthier and has a lower risk of age-related diseases.

Prioritizing Nutrient-Dense Nutrition
What you eat provides the building blocks for every cell in your body. A diet rich in anti-inflammatory foods and antioxidants can protect your cells from damage and support their natural repair processes.
- Focus on a Mediterranean-style diet: This includes plenty of fruits, vegetables, whole grains, nuts, seeds, and healthy fats like olive oil. This pattern has been linked to a reduced risk of heart disease, lower inflammation, and better brain health.
- Increase omega-3 fatty acids: Found in oily fish, walnuts, and flaxseeds, these fats are crucial for cellular health and reducing inflammation.
- Incorporate antioxidants: Berries, dark leafy greens, and colorful vegetables are packed with antioxidants that combat oxidative stress, a key driver of aging.
- Consider intermittent fasting: Some research suggests that moderate caloric restriction and timed eating windows may trigger cellular repair processes and boost longevity pathways.
The Critical Role of Exercise
Physical activity is one of the most powerful tools for influencing biological age. It goes beyond weight management, affecting everything from mitochondrial function to cardiovascular health.
- Combine resistance and cardio training: Weightlifting builds muscle mass, which declines with age, and boosts growth hormone. High-intensity interval training (HIIT) has been shown to improve mitochondrial health, the powerhouses of your cells.
- Aim for consistency: Studies show that regular, moderate exercise—about 150 minutes per week—can make a significant impact. It reduces blood pressure and blood sugar, which are both biological age indicators.
- Prioritize flexibility: Activities like yoga or dynamic stretching improve joint health and mobility, which can be negatively impacted by a sedentary lifestyle.
The Power of Restorative Sleep
During sleep, your body performs essential cellular repair and maintenance. Chronic sleep deprivation heightens inflammatory markers and can accelerate biological aging.
- Aim for 7–9 hours per night: Consistency is key. Create a relaxing bedtime routine to help you wind down and improve the quality of your sleep.
- Optimize your sleep environment: Ensure your bedroom is dark, cool, and quiet. Consider blackout curtains or a white noise machine if needed.
- Address underlying issues: If you struggle with insomnia or other sleep disorders, consult a doctor to explore solutions, as untreated issues can significantly impact your healthspan.
Managing Stress Effectively
Chronic stress has a measurable impact on your cells, contributing to shorter telomeres and higher oxidative stress. Learning to manage stress is not just for your mental health; it's a critical anti-aging strategy.
- Incorporate mindfulness and meditation: These practices can lower cortisol levels and promote a sense of calm. Even a few minutes of deep breathing can make a difference.
- Spend time in nature: Studies show that time outdoors can lower blood pressure and reduce stress hormones.
- Cultivate social connections: A strong social network provides a buffer against stress and is strongly correlated with a longer, healthier life.

A Comparison of Anti-Aging Approaches
Approach | Key Actions | Impact on Biological Age | Evidence Level |
---|---|---|---|
Dietary Intervention | Focuses on whole foods, plant-based or Mediterranean diets, and caloric restriction. | Reduces inflammation, oxidative stress, and improves metabolic markers. | High (Extensive human and animal studies) |
Regular Exercise | Combines aerobic, resistance, and flexibility training. | Boosts mitochondrial function, strengthens cardiovascular system, and reduces inflammation. | High (Comprehensive human studies) |
Optimal Sleep | Ensuring 7-9 hours of quality, restorative sleep nightly. | Supports cellular repair, reduces inflammatory markers, and aids hormonal balance. | High (Strong observational and controlled studies) |
Stress Management | Practices like meditation, yoga, and mindfulness. | Reduces cortisol levels, combats oxidative stress, and protects telomeres. | Moderate (Growing body of research) |
Supplementation | Using targeted supplements like CoQ10, omega-3s, and NAD+ boosters. | Supports cellular energy production and reduces inflammation. | Moderate (Emerging research, varies by supplement) |
